Gartner Inc (IT) - Total Assets
Based on the latest financial reports, Gartner Inc (IT) holds total assets worth $8.09 Billion USD as of December 2025. Total assets represent everything the company owns and controls, combining both current assets—like cash and cash equivalents, accounts receivable, and inventories—and non-current assets such as property, plant, equipment (PP&E), intangible assets, and long-term investments. Gartner Inc - Asset Composition Analysis
Current Asset Composition (December 2025)
Gartner Inc's total assets of $8.09 Billion consist of 50.3% current assets and 49.7% non-current assets.
| Asset Category | Amount (USD) | % of Total Assets |
|---|---|---|
| Cash & Equivalents | $1.72 Billion | 21.3% |
| Accounts Receivable | $1.68 Billion | 20.8% |
| Inventory | $0.00 | 0.0% |
| Property, Plant & Equipment | $428.18 Million | 5.3% |
| Intangible Assets | $336.30 Million | 4.2% |
| Goodwill | $2.74 Billion | 33.9% |

Key Asset Composition Facts
- Current vs. Non-Current Assets: Gartner Inc's current assets represent 50.3% of total assets in 2025, a decrease from 57.3% in 1993.
- Cash Position: Cash and equivalents constituted 21.3% of total assets in 2025, up from 4.8% in 1993.
- Tangible vs. Intangible: Intangible assets (including goodwill) make up 37.0% of total assets, an increase from 34.0% in 1993.
- Asset Diversification: The largest asset category is goodwill at 33.9% of total assets.

Annual Total Assets for Gartner Inc (1993–2025)
The table below shows the annual total assets of Gartner Inc from 1993 to 2025.
| Year | Total Assets | Change |
|---|---|---|
| 2025-12-31 | $8.09 Billion | -5.26% |
| 2024-12-31 | $8.53 Billion | +8.92% |
| 2023-12-31 | $7.84 Billion | +7.35% |
| 2022-12-31 | $7.30 Billion | -1.57% |
| 2021-12-31 | $7.42 Billion | +1.37% |
| 2020-12-31 | $7.32 Billion | +2.30% |
| 2019-12-31 | $7.15 Billion | +15.32% |
| 2018-12-31 | $6.20 Billion | -14.85% |
| 2017-12-31 | $7.28 Billion | +207.65% |
| 2016-12-31 | $2.37 Billion | +8.86% |
| 2015-12-31 | $2.17 Billion | +14.20% |
| 2014-12-31 | $1.90 Billion | +6.77% |
| 2013-12-31 | $1.78 Billion | +10.01% |
| 2012-12-31 | $1.62 Billion | +17.49% |
| 2011-12-31 | $1.38 Billion | +7.33% |
| 2010-12-31 | $1.29 Billion | +5.79% |
| 2009-12-31 | $1.22 Billion | +11.18% |
| 2008-12-31 | $1.09 Billion | -3.54% |
| 2007-12-31 | $1.13 Billion | +8.98% |
| 2006-12-31 | $1.04 Billion | +1.28% |
| 2005-12-31 | $1.03 Billion | +19.21% |
| 2004-12-31 | $861.19 Million | -6.11% |
| 2003-12-31 | $917.26 Million | +10.86% |
| 2002-12-31 | $827.40 Million | -1.38% |
| 2001-12-31 | $839.00 Million | -11.83% |
| 2000-12-31 | $951.58 Million | +18.44% |
| 1999-12-31 | $803.40 Million | -3.54% |
| 1998-12-31 | $832.90 Million | +29.07% |
| 1997-12-31 | $645.30 Million | +45.31% |
| 1996-12-31 | $444.10 Million | +47.74% |
| 1995-12-31 | $300.60 Million | +29.23% |
| 1994-12-31 | $232.60 Million | +73.97% |
| 1993-12-31 | $133.70 Million | -- |
